SUMMARY:321Go! Building Healthy Habits!
DESCRIPTION:321Go! Let’s Get Healthy!\n\nEvent Description: \n\n321Go! Building Healthy Habits is an eight-week program designed by the National Down Syndrome Society to promote healthy lifestyle choices in physical activity\, balanced nutrition\, and emotional wellness among adults with Down syndrome and their families. Every VIP/Parent\, Sibling\, Guardian Team will receive an NDSS 321 Go Kit with your registration. \nProgram Dates: 4/9\, 4/16\, 4/23\, 4/30\, 5/7\, 5/14\, 5/21\, 5/28 \nWe are excited to welcome our program instructor\, Rachel Berry! Rachel Berry Rachel Berry is a playful\, welcoming\, and down-to-earth movement teacher with over 10 years of experience in the fitness and wellness world. Beginning her wellness journey teaching indoor cycling\, she expanded into group exercise\, and is currently both a teacher and the Director of Operations at Humble Haven Yoga. Passionate about movement\, breathwork\, and mindful living\, Rachel’s mission is to share yoga as a tool for transformation—helping people learn how to make choices from a centered place\, and to cultivate awareness that shapes our everyday lives. \nCost: Program cost- $120 (per parent/child team) \nAll abilities welcome! Must be 18 or over to participate and be accompanied by an 18+ parent/sibling/guardian. \n\n\nSign Up Here: 1321Go! Building Health Choices

SUMMARY:Richmond - Nate's Promise Art in and With Nature
DESCRIPTION:Nate’s Promise Art in and With Nature\n\nNate’s Promise is hosting a 4-week art course for people with congenital conditions that affect their cognitive and motor capabilities taught by VCU Art students and Nate’s Promise members. \nDate: Sundays\, April 5 – April 26 \nTime: 4 pm-5:30 pm \nLocation: 822 W Broad St (on VCU campus). \nArt in and With Nature is an inclusive art program for people with diverse learning and sensory needs. Participants will explore nature through guided\, hands-on art activities using natural materials\, while developing creativity\, confidence\, and self-expression in a supportive\, small-group environment. \nThe objectives of the course:\n– Provide an inclusive and creative experience\n– Offer a safe space to promote self-expression through art\n– Foster a sense of accomplishment and pride through completing art projects\n– Develop foundational art skills and vocabulary \nParticipants must be between the ages of 13 and 21 years. All participants under the age of 18 will need a parent\, caregiver\, or support person to stay for the entire class. \n\nSign Up Here: Nate’s Promise Art in and With Nature
